New swimming pool planned for Kato Polemidia

(Christos Theodorides)

The Kato Polemidia municipality plans to build a new Olympic sized swimming pool in the Verengaria area, the Cyprus Sports Organisation (Koa) said on Friday.

The pool will be for athletes, citizens, and international purposes for sports tourism. Limassol nautical club coaches plan to offer programmes to young people, students, and disabled persons.

Koa president Andreas Michaelides met Kato Polemidia mayor Nicos Anastasiou on the matter on Thursday night.
